Heart and Lung Qi Deficiency

A deficiency of Heart-Qi can create a Lung deficiency and vice versa. There will be a deficiency of Qi in the Upper Burner. See: Heart Syndromes, Lung Syndromes.

Symptoms:

  • Palpitations
  • Shortness of breath
  • Cough
  • Asthma (aggravated by physical exertion)
  • Weak voice, reluctance to speak
  • Spontaneous sweating
  • Propensity to catch a cold
  • Aversion to cold
  • Depressed, apathetic mood
  • Oedema of the face and four limbs
  • Pale tongue with thin, whitish coating
  • Deep and weak pulse
